Output 105d6ff559666b5d508569da3945c11b00bfd36dcd4ae3c7ffd190129642f12e:0

value
59159600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e24b5c628367589e7994812e33b727ffa431b8f9 OP_EQUALVERIFY OP_CHECKSIG
address
1MdXzX7tJCY3FKsbengrMDWyLiL2wvzVcz
transaction
105d6ff559666b5d508569da3945c11b00bfd36dcd4ae3c7ffd190129642f12e
spent
true